A SIP (Systematic Investment Plan) calculator is an online financial tool that estimates the future value of a mutual fund investment made through regular monthly SIP contributions — based on inputs of the monthly SIP amount, expected annual return rate, and investment tenure. It uses the Future Value of an Annuity formula: FV = P × [(1+r)^n – 1] ÷ r × (1+r), where P is the monthly SIP amount, r is the monthly return rate, and n is the number of months. The SIP calculator powerfully illustrates the compounding effect over time — a ₹10,000 monthly SIP at a 12% annual return over 20 years grows to approximately ₹99 lakh, despite total principal contributions of only ₹24 lakh. In India, SIP calculators have been instrumental in driving mutual fund adoption among retail investors — AMFI's 'Mutual Funds Sahi Hai' campaign prominently features SIP calculators to visually demonstrate long-term wealth creation potential. Many Indian AMC and brokerage websites, including Ventura, offer SIP calculators with step-up SIP functionality — showing how increasing the SIP amount annually by a fixed percentage (typically 10% to 15% in line with salary increments) dramatically accelerates corpus accumulation. For investors setting financial goals, the SIP calculator helps determine the required monthly investment amount needed to reach a specific target corpus within a defined timeline.
